Here's the latest on three transportation projects either underway or planned in the Lake Houston area. This list is not comprehensive.
Upcoming projects
West Lake Houston Parkway traffic lights
Project: Traffic lights will be rebuilt at five intersections along West Lake Houston Parkway, including at Firesign Drive, Kings River Drive/Kings Lake Estates Boulevard, Lonesome Woods Trail, Pine Cup Drive and Upper Lake Drive.
Update: The design phase has been completed for this project, and construction is pending funding, Precinct 3 Communications Manager Jeannie Peng said June 10.
Timber Forest Drive, Greens Road traffic light
Project: A new traffic signal will be installed at the intersection of Timber Forest Drive and Greens Road. The project aims to increase driver safety.
Update: This project is out of the design phase, Peng said. Construction is scheduled to begin in the third quarter of 2026.
- Timeline: third quarter of 2026-TBD
- Cost: $610,000
- Funding source: Harris County Precinct 3
Ongoing projects
Sand Creek Village drainage improvements
Project: Drainage improvements are being made along portions of several roadways in Sand Creek Village, including Crystal Falls Drive, Woodland Ridge Drive, Eagle Creek Drive, Deer Hollow Drive and Highland Laurels Drive.
Update: The project is expected to be substantially complete by July 13, weather permitting, officials with Houston City Council member Fred Flickinger's office confirmed on June 17.
